Docker新建应用容器引擎与启动ssh服务

XZ的账户资料:

使用SecureCRT的ssh2协议远程登陆

ip: 192.XXX.X.XXX

port: XXXX

用户名:xiaohua

密码:123456

$ docker run --name xiaohua_docker -p xxxxx:xx -it -v /home/d/xiaohua:/home/xiaohuac522ac0d6194 bash //将真实路径/home/d/xiaohua映射到docker路径/home/xiaohua,在docker路径下进行开发

$ docker ps -a

CONTAINER ID IMAGE COMMAND CREATED STATUS PORTS NAMES

d5f1f550ddfe c522ac0d6194 "bash" 19 seconds ago Exited (0) 5 seconds ago xiaohua_docker

$ docker start xiaohua_docker

$ docker exec -it xiaohua_docker /bin/bash

//安装ssh工具

$ apt-get update

$ apt-get install openssh-server

$ /etc/init.d/ssh restart

(1)切换超级用户,密码123456

$ sudo su

(2) 添加用户

$ adduser xiaohua

Adding user `xiaohua' ...

Adding new group `xiaohua' (1007) ...

Adding new user `xiaohua' (1008) with group `wanggang' ...

Creating home directory `/home/xiaohua' ...

Copying files from `/etc/skel' ...

Enter new UNIX password: (123456)

Retype new UNIX password: (123456)

passwd: password updated successfully

Changing the user information for xiaohua

Enter the new value, or press ENTER for the default

Full Name []: xiaohua(输入全名)

Room Number []:

Work Phone []:

Home Phone []:

Other []:

Is the information correct? [Y/n] y (输入y确认)

(3)给当前用户创建root权限和密码

#passwd root //赋予当前账户xiaohua的root权限

#123456 //设置密码:123456

(4) 退出超级用户

$ exit

相关推荐
huangyuchi.2 分钟前
【Linux网络】UDP协议详解:透过源码看透“面向数据报”与“缓冲区”的本质
linux·网络·udp·报文·linux网络·传输层协议·报头
林九生2 分钟前
【Centos7】CentOS 7 yum源失效解决方案:Could not resolve host mirrorlist.centos.org
linux·运维·centos
福尔摩斯张4 分钟前
【实战】C/C++ 实现 PC 热点(手动开启)+ 手机 UDP 自动发现 + TCP 通信全流程(超详细)
linux·c语言·c++·tcp/ip·算法·智能手机·udp
了一梨7 分钟前
网络编程:UDP Socket
linux·网络协议·udp
ChristXlx15 分钟前
Linux安装MongoDB(虚拟机适用)
linux·mongodb·postgresql
AttaGain16 分钟前
禁用Ubuntu24.04休眠模式
linux
kaka_199416 分钟前
如何解决驱动程序无法通过使用安全套接字层(SSL)加密与 SQL Server 建立安全连接。
linux·安全·ssl
我是谁??20 分钟前
windows11的ubuntu子系统如何识别到U盘
linux·运维·ubuntu
sean90820 分钟前
Colima 下 docker pull 失败自查流程
macos·docker·容器·colima
qq_4557608521 分钟前
docker - 虚拟化和容器化
linux·运维·服务器